The view of the lake from our room, the bathroom was really great and spacious as well! It had the carpark and also a bus stop nearby which was helpful once we had to return our car.
The restaurant, it needs some updating I believe. We went a few times and the food was lovely, don’t get me wrong but maybe a buffet style for breakfast would be more practical rather than waiting for our food for long periods of time and it seemed a little understaffed at times and the poor staff member was alone/struggling so I think a buffet styled breakfast (it seemed like it had space for one) would make it. The pool facility as well, it looked nice but was a shallow pool and maybe needs some updating ? The hot tub part was nice and a free spa facility inside with the pool would be good ? But I understand due to hot tubs it may not have that (strangely some photos do show that they had one at some period of time?)

We were happy with our room, which was a generous size. We chose the garden view, which was pleasant but I would really recommend choosing a river view room, if possible, as it is absolutely spectacular! The restaurant overlooks this vista and we were lucky enough to sit at a table by the window for breakfast on both mornings we stayed. The breakfasts were very good. The hotel is a few miles outside Queenstown and very easy to drive to and from.
Unfortunately, the restaurant was closed on both days we stayed. Luckily, there was one restaurant open just along the road, within walking distance, on our first night as we had driven a long way and didn't really feel like a drive into town. I would recommend checking to see whether the facilities are fully open. I noticed that the Spa also had a couple of closed areas (ie steam room) and the pool itself was pretty cold. While I enjoyed staying here, there were signs here and there that some upgrading and maintenance is due.

We stayed 4 nights at the Nugget Resort and it was great, right from the afternoon of our arrival till the morning we checked out. We were warmly welcomed by the lovely charming Beatrice on Reception who proved invaluable because we had never been to Queenstown before and had endless questions about everything. Beatrice was a font of information. We were quite demanding guests and she answered all our queries in a very polite friendly helpful manner which we so appreciated. Thank you Beatrice. The room was huge and had a sofa with coffee table and a balcony overlooking the garden which was pretty. The bed was very comfortable and we loved the luxurious crisp white bed linen. The bathroom was well appointed with a shower and a tub and well maintained and everything worked. There was a small heated cupboard which was great to dry out our swimwear but I suppose it’s really for drying out ski clothes. Everything in the room was meticulously clean. In fact the whole Resort was very clean and well maintained. The Breakfast was good and plenty of it. We took daily advantage of the Swimming Pool, Sauna, Steam Room and Jucuzzi. Tub. We really appreciated having those facilities available late into the evening. The Resort is set in an absolutely stunning location with spectacular views over the mountains and river. It’s at Arthurs Point, above Queenstown and about 10 to 15 minutes in a car or bus from downtown Queenstown. We actually found this to be an advantage. Queenstown is very busy and it was nice to “come home” to the peace and tranquility of this hotel. And to see Beatrice on Reception and have a little chat about our adventures of the day. She really did help make our stay extra special. You can get an Uber or a Taxi into town for between $20-$40 depending on the time of day.
